ARTICLE II -- THE CREDITS
2.1. Commitments. The Lender agrees, on and subject to the terms and
conditions set forth in this Agreement, to make Loans to the Borrower.
2.1.1 Aggregate Revolving Loan Commitment. From and including the
date of this Agreement and prior to the Revolving Commitment Termination Date,
the Lender, subject to the terms and conditions herein, agrees to make Revolving
Loans in amounts not to exceed in the aggregate at any one time outstanding the
amount of the Aggregate Revolving Loan Commitment. Subject to Section 2.5, the
Borrower may permanently reduce the Aggregate Revolving Loan Commitment, in
integral multiples of Yen 50,000,000, upon at least five Business Days' written
notice to the Lender; provided, however, that the amount of the Commitment may
not be reduced below the aggregate principal amount of the outstanding Revolving
Loans.
2.1.2 Aggregate Term Loans. This Agreement re-evidences and amends
and restates the indebtedness of the Borrower to the Lender in connection with
term loans made by the Lender to the Borrower pursuant to that certain Loan
Agreement dated March 27, 2002 by Borrower and Lender and any notes issued in
connection therewith.
2.2. Types of Loans; Minimum Amount; Lending Installations.
2.2.1 Revolving Loans. Subject to the terms of this Agreement, the
Borrower with respect to Revolving Loans may borrow, repay and reborrow at any
time prior to the Revolving Commitment Termination Date and provided that the
aggregate of Revolving Loans at any one time outstanding shall not exceed the
amount of the Aggregate Revolving Loan Commitment.
2.2.2 Term Loans. Subject to Section 2.3.3 below, the Term Loans may
be prepaid at any time in whole or in part in minimum amounts of Yen 50,000,000
or the outstanding balance if less. Once repaid, Term Loans may not be
reborrowed.
2.2.3 Minimum Amount. Each Loan shall be in the minimum amount of
Yen 50,000,000 or any lesser amount of the balance of the Commitment.
-5-
2.2.4 Lending Installations. The Lender may book the Loans at any
Lending Installation, as selected by the Lender. All terms of the Loan Documents
shall apply to and may be enforced by or on behalf of any such Lending
Installation.
2.3. Principal Payments.
2.3.1 Term Loan Principal Payments. No Term Loan may be prepaid
prior to the Term Loan Termination Date without payment of related breakage
costs pursuant to Section 2.3.3 below. Outstanding principal for each Term Loan
shall be repaid in one lump sum at maturity on the Term Loan Termination Date.
2.3.2 Revolving Loan Principal Payments. The Borrower may from time
to time pay, without penalty or premium, all outstanding Revolving Loans, or, in
a minimum aggregate amount of Yen 50,000,000 or any integral multiple of Yen
50,000,000 in excess thereof, any portion of the outstanding Revolving Loans
upon three Business Days' prior notice to the Lender.
2.3.3 Borrower Indemnity. If any payment of principal occurs with
respect to a Revolving Loan or a Term Loan , whether because of acceleration,
prepayment or otherwise, or if a Revolving Loan or a Term Loan is not made on
the date specified by the Borrower for any reason other than default by the
Lender, then the Borrower will indemnify the Lender for any loss or cost
incurred by it resulting therefrom, including, without limitation, any loss or
cost in liquidating or employing deposits acquired to fund or maintain the Loan.
2.3.4 Payment of Outstanding Amounts. Any outstanding Loans and all
other unpaid Obligations shall be paid in full by the Borrower, and the Lender's
commitments to lend hereunder shall expire, on (a) with respect to the Revolving
Loans, the Revolving Commitment Termination Date, and (b) otherwise, the Term
Loan Termination Date.
2.4. Commitment Fee. The Borrower agrees to pay to the Lender commitment
fees which shall accrue at (a) the Applicable Commitment Fee Rate on the daily
unborrowed portion of the Aggregate Revolving Loan Commitment from the date
hereof to and including the Revolving Commitment Termination Date, and (b) the
Applicable Commitment Fee Rate on the daily unborrowed portion of the Aggregate
Term Loan Commitment from the date hereof to and including the Term Commitment
Termination Date. Such commitment fees shall be calculated by the Lender and be
payable on the last day of each sixth month hereafter and on the Revolving
Commitment Termination Date and the Term Commitment Termination Date,
respectively. All accrued fees shall be payable on the effective date of any
termination of the obligations of the Lender to make Loans hereunder.
2.5. Revolving Loan Minimum Usage. With respect to Revolving Loans, the
Borrower agrees to maintain an average outstanding principal amount borrowed
hereunder of at least 50% of the Aggregate Revolving Loan Commitment, as
calculated by the Lender every six months hereafter, based upon a 364 or 365-day
year. If the Borrower fails to maintain such minimum amount, the Borrower shall
pay the Lender such amount that, together with any interest paid with respect to
the outstanding Revolving Loans, equals the total amount of interest that would
have accrued and been payable if the Borrower had maintained such minimum
-6-
amount. Such amount shall be calculated by the Lender and be payable on the last
day of each sixth month hereafter and on the Revolving Commitment Termination
Date.
2.6 Notice of New Loans. The Borrower shall select the Interest Period,
if any, applicable to each Revolving Loan from time to time. The Borrower shall
give the Lender irrevocable notice (a "Borrowing Notice") not later than 10:00
a.m. (Tokyo time) at least three Business Day before the Borrowing Date of each
Loan, specifying for each Loan: (i) the Borrowing Date, which shall be a
Business Day, (ii) the aggregate amount, (iii) whether such Loan is to be a
Revolving Loan or Term Loan, and (iv) with respect to Revolving Loans, the
Interest Period, if any, applicable thereto. The Lender will make the funds
available to the Borrower at the Lender's address specified pursuant to Article
XII.
2.7 Changes in Interest Rate. Each Revolving Loan shall bear interest on
the outstanding principal amount thereof for each day during the Interest Period
applicable thereto from and including the first day of such Interest Period to
(but not including) the last day of such Interest Period at the Revolving Loan
Rate applicable thereto. No Interest Period may end after the Revolving
Commitment Termination Date.
2.8. Rates Applicable After Default. During the continuance of a Default,
the Lender may, at its option, by notice to the Borrower, declare that each Loan
shall bear interest at the rate otherwise applicable plus 1% per annum, provided
that, during the continuance of a Default under Section 7.2, 7.6 or 7.7, such
interest rate shall be applicable to all Loans without any election or action on
the part of the Lender.
2.9. Method of Payment; Taxes. All payments of the Obligations hereunder
shall be made, without setoff, deduction, or counterclaim, in immediately
available funds to the Lender at the Lender's address, by 2:00 p.m. (local time)
on the date when due. The Lender is hereby authorized to charge the account of
the Borrower maintained with the Lender for each payment of principal, interest
and fees as it becomes due hereunder. Any and all payments made by the Borrower
under this Agreement shall be made free and clear of, and without deduction or
withholding for or on account of, any present or future income, stamp or other
taxes, levies, imposts, duties, charges, fees, deductions or withholdings, now
or hereafter imposed, levied, collected, withheld or assessed by any
governmental authority in respect of any jurisdiction from or through which any
payment is made hereunder (collectively, "Taxes"), excluding net income taxes
and franchise taxes (imposed in lieu of net income taxes) imposed on the Lender.
If any such non-excluded taxes, levies, imposts, duties, charges, fees,
deductions or withholdings ("Non-Excluded Taxes") are required to be withheld or
deducted from any amounts payable to the Lender hereunder, the amounts so
payable to the Lender shall be increased to the extent necessary to compensate
the Lender (after payment of all such Non-Excluded Taxes) for interest or any
such other amounts payable hereunder at the rates or in the amounts specified in
this Agreement so that such net sum is equal to what the Lender would have
received and so retained had no such deduction or withholding been required or
made.
2.10. Evidence of Indebtedness. The Lender shall maintain in accordance
with its usual practice an account or accounts in which it will record (a) the
amount of each Loan made hereunder, and, for Revolving Loans, the Interest
Period with respect thereto, (b) the amount of any principal or interest due and
payable or to become due and payable from the Borrower to the
-7-
Lender hereunder and (c) the amount of any sum received by the Lender hereunder
from the Borrower. The entries maintained in such accounts shall be prima facie
evidence of the existence and amounts of the Obligations therein recorded;
provided, however, that the failure of the Lender to maintain such accounts or
any error therein shall not in any manner affect the obligation of the Borrower
to repay the Obligations in accordance with their terms. The Loans will be
evidenced by promissory notes ("Notes") in a form supplied by the Lender.
2.11. Notices. The Borrower hereby authorizes the Lender to extend or
continue Loans, to transfer funds and otherwise take actions with respect to
this agreement based on written notices made by any person or persons the Lender
in good faith believes to be acting on behalf of the Borrower and listed on
Schedule A (as the same may be amended from time to time by written notice from
the Borrower to the Lender). If the Borrower's records differ in any material
respect from the action taken by the Lender, the records of the Lender shall
govern absent manifest error.
2.12. Interest Payment Dates; Interest and Fee Basis.
2.12.1 Revolving Loans. Interest accrued on each Revolving Loan
shall be payable on the last day of its applicable Interest Period, on any date
on which the Revolving Loan is prepaid, whether by acceleration or otherwise,
and at maturity. Interest accrued on each Revolving Loan having an Interest
Period longer than three months shall also be payable on the last day of each
three-month interval during such Interest Period.
2.12.2 Term Loans. Interest accrued on each Term Loan shall be
payable on the last day of each three-month interval beginning on the
disbursement of such Loan, on any date on which the Term Loan is prepaid in
accordance with the terms hereof, whether by acceleration or otherwise, and at
maturity.
2.12.3 Calculations. Interest and commitment fees shall be
calculated for actual days elapsed on the basis of a 364 or 365-day year.
Interest shall be payable for the day a Loan is made but not for the day of any
payment if payment is received prior to 2:00 p.m. (local time) at the place of
payment. If any payment of principal of or interest on a Loan shall become due
on a day which is not a Business Day, such payment shall be made on the next
succeeding Business Day and, in the case of a principal payment, such extension
of time shall be included in computing interest in connection with such payment.

ARTICLE VII -- DEFAULTS
The occurrence of any one or more of the following events shall constitute
a Default:
7.1. Any representation or warranty made or deemed made by or on behalf
of the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ries to the Lender under or in connection
with this Agreement, any Loan, or any certificate or information delivered in
connection with this Agreement or any other Loan Document shall be materially
false on the date as of which made.
7.2. Nonpayment of principal of any Loan when due, or nonpayment of
interest upon any Loan or of any commitment fee or other obligations under any
of the Loan Documents within five days after the same becomes due.
7.3. The breach by the Borrower of any of the terms or provisions of
Section 6.2(a) or 6.3.
7.4. The breach by the Borrower (other than a breach which constitutes a
Default under another Section of this Article VII) of any of the terms or
provisions of this Agreement which is not remedied within thirty days after the
occurrence thereof.
7.5. Failure of the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ries or any Guarantors
to pay any Indebtedness when due; or a default shall occur under any agreement
governing any Indebtedness of the Borrower or any Subsidiary or any Guarantors
or any other event shall occur or condition shall exist, the effect of which
default, event or condition is to cause, or to permit the holder or holders of
such Indebtedness to cause, such Indebtedness to become due prior to its stated
maturity; or any Indebtedness of the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ries or any
Guarantors shall be declared to be due and payable or required to be prepaid or
repurchased (other than by a regularly scheduled payment) prior to the stated
maturity thereof; or the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ries or any Guarantors
shall not pay, or admit in writing its inability to pay, its debts generally as
they become due.
7.6. The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ries shall (i) have an order for
relief entered with respect to it under the bankruptcy, insolvency or
reorganization laws as now or hereafter in effect, (ii) make an assignment for
the benefit of creditors, (iii) apply for, seek, consent to, or acquiesce in,
the appointment of a receiver, custodian, trustee, examiner, liquidator or
similar official for it or any substantial portion of its Property, (iv)
institute any proceeding seeking an order for relief under the bankruptcy,
insolvency or reorganization laws as now or hereafter in effect or seeking to
adjudicate it a bankrupt or insolvent, or seeking dissolution, winding up,
liquidation, reorganization, arrangement, adjustment or composition of it or its
debts under any law relating to bankruptcy, insolvency or reorganization or
relief of debtors or fail to file an answer or other pleading denying the
material allegations of any such proceeding filed against it,
-13-
(v) take any action to authorize or effect any of the foregoing actions set
forth in this Section 7.6 or (vi) fail to contest in good faith any appointment
or proceeding described in Section 7.7.
7.7. Without the application, approval or consent of the Borrower or any
of its Subsidiaries, a receiver, trustee, examiner, liquidator or similar
official shall be appointed for the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ries or any
substantial portion of its Property, or a proceeding described in Section
7.6(iv) shall be instituted against the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ries and
such appointment continues undischarged or such proceeding continues undismissed
or unstayed for a period of 60 consecutive days.
7.8. The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ries shall fail within 30 days to
pay, bond or otherwise discharge one or more (i) judgments or orders for the
payment of money in excess of Yen 50,000,000 or the equivalent in the aggregate,
or (ii) nonmonetary judgments or orders which, individually or in the aggregate,
could reasonably be expected to have a Material Adverse Effect, which
judgment(s), in any such case, is/are not stayed on appeal or otherwise being
appropriately contested in good faith.
7.9. The Parent shall cease to own, directly or indirectly, free and
clear of all Liens or other encumbrances, all of the outstanding shares of
voting stock of the Borrower on a fully diluted basis.
7.10. The Guaranty shall fail to remain in full force or effect or any
action shall be taken to discontinue or to assert the invalidity or
unenforceability of the Guaranty, or the Guarantors shall fail to comply with
any of the terms or provisions of the Guaranty, or any Guarantor denies that it
has any further liability under the Guaranty, or gives notice to such effect.
ARTICLE VIII -- ACCELERATION, WAIVERS, AMENDMENTS AND REMEDIES
8.1. Acceleration. If any Default described in Section 7.6 or 7.7 occurs
with respect to the Borrower, the obligation of the Lender to make Loans
hereunder shall automatically terminate and the Obligations shall immediately
become due and payable without any election or action on the part of the Lender.
If any other Default occurs, the Lender may terminate or suspend the obligations
to make Loans hereunder, or declare the Obligations to be due and payable, or
both, whereupon the Obligations shall become immediately due and payable,
without presentment, demand, protest or notice of any kind, all of which the
Borrower hereby expressly waives.
8.2. Amendments. Subject to the provisions of this Article VIII, the
Lender and the Borrower may enter into agreements supplemental hereto for the
purpose of amending the Loan Documents in any manner or waiving any Default
hereunder.
8.3. Preservation of Rights. No delay or omission of the Lender to
exercise any right under the Loan Documents shall impair such right or be
construed to be a waiver of any Default or an acquiescence therein, and the
making of a Loan notwithstanding the existence of a Default or the inability of
the Borrower to satisfy the conditions precedent to such Loan shall not
constitute any waiver or acquiescence. Any single or partial exercise of any
such right shall not
-14-
preclude other or further exercise thereof or the exercise of any other right,
and no waiver, amendment or other variation of the terms, conditions or
provisions of the Loan Documents whatsoever shall be valid unless in writing
signed by the Borrower and the Lender, and then only to the extent in such
writing specifically set forth. All remedies contained in the Loan Documents or
by law afforded shall be cumulative and all shall be available to the Lender
until the Obligations have been paid in full.

9.6. Subordination of Intercompany Indebtedness. The Borrower agrees that
any and all claims of the Borrower against any Guarantor with respect to any
"Intercompany Indebtedness" (as hereinafter defined), any endorser, obligor or
any other guarantor of all or any part of the Obligations, or against any of its
properties shall be subordinate and subject in right of payment to the prior
payment, in full and in cash, of all Obligations; provided that, and not in
contravention of the foregoing, so long as no Default has occurred and is
continuing the Borrower may make loans to and receive payments in the ordinary
course with respect to such Intercompany Indebtedness from each such Guarantor
to the extent not prohibited by the terms of this Agreement and the other Loan
Documents. Notwithstanding any right of the Borrower to ask, demand, xxx for,
take or receive any payment from any Guarantor, all rights, liens and security
interests of the Borrower, whether now or hereafter arising and howsoever
existing, in any assets of any Guarantor shall be and are subordinated to the
rights of the Lender in those assets. The Borrower shall have no right to
possession of any such asset or to foreclose upon any such asset, whether by
judicial action or otherwise, unless and until all of the Obligations (other
than contingent indemnity obligations) shall have been fully paid and satisfied
(in cash) and all financing arrangements pursuant to any Loan Document or
Hedging Agreement between the Borrower and the Lender (or any affiliate thereof)
have been terminated. If all or any part of the assets of any Guarantor, or the
proceeds thereof, are subject to any distribution, division or application to
the creditors of such Guarantor, whether partial or complete, voluntary or
involuntary, and whether by reason of liquidation, bankruptcy, arrangement,
receivership, assignment for the benefit of creditors or any other action or
proceeding, or if the business of any
-16-
such Guarantor is dissolved or if substantially all of the assets of any such
Guarantor are sold, then, and in any such event (such events being herein
referred to as an "INSOLVENCY EVENT"), any payment or distribution of any kind
or character, either in cash, securities or other property, which shall be
payable or deliverable upon or with respect to any indebtedness of any Guarantor
to the Borrower ("INTERCOMPANY INDEBTEDNESS") shall be paid or delivered
directly to the Lender for application on any of the Obligations, due or to
become due, until such Obligations (other than contingent indemnity obligations)
shall have first been fully paid and satisfied (in cash). Should any payment,
distribution, security or instrument or proceeds thereof be received by the
Borrower upon or with respect to the Intercompany Indebtedness after an
Insolvency Event prior to the satisfaction of all of the Obligations (other than
contingent indemnity obligations) and the termination of all financing
arrangements pursuant to any Loan Document between the Borrower and the Lender,
the Borrower shall receive and hold the same in trust, as trustee, for the
Lender and shall forthwith deliver the same to the Lender, for the benefit of
such Persons, in precisely the form received (except for the endorsement or
assignment of the Borrower where necessary), for application to any of the
Obligations, due or not due, and, until so delivered, the same shall be held in
trust by the Borrower as the property of the Lender. If the Borrower fails to
make any such endorsement or assignment to the Lender, the Lender or any of its
officers or employees are irrevocably authorized to make the same. The Borrower
agrees that until the Obligations (other than the contingent indemnity
obligations) have been paid in full (in cash) and satisfied and all financing
arrangements pursuant to any Loan Document between the Borrower and the Lender
have been terminated, the Borrower will not assign or transfer to any Person
(other than the Lender) any claim the Borrower has or may have against any
Guarantor.
ARTICLE X -- SETOFF
In addition to, and without limitation of, any rights of the Lender under
applicable law, if the Borrower becomes insolvent, however evidenced, or any
Default occurs, any and all deposits (including all account balances, whether
provisional or final and whether or not collected or available) and any other
Indebtedness at any time held or owing by the Lender or any affiliate of the
Lender to or for the credit or account of the Borrower may be offset and applied
toward the payment of the Obligations owing to the Lender, whether or not the
Obligations, or any part hereof, shall then be due.
